Maniac magee, written by jerry spinelli in 1990 and winner of the newbery medal in 1991, follows an orphaned boy named jeffery lionel magee colloquially maniac magee as he seeks out a home and confronts the racism of the 1980s1990s in the fictional city of two mills, pennsylvania. Jerry spinelli is the author of over fifteen immensely popular books for young readers, including eggs, stargirl, space station seventh grade, newbery honor winner wringer, and maniac magee, winner of more than fifteen state childrens book awards in addition to the newbery medal.
